KIP RHINELANDER FORCED TO PAY WIFE'S LAWYERS AN ADDITIONAL $1500

(Preston News Service)

White Plains, N. Y., March 18.—For presenting the case of Mrs. Alice Jones Rhinelander in the annulment action of her husband, Leonard Kip Rhinelander, in the court of appeals at Albany, Lee Parsons Davis and Samuel F. Swinburne, Mrs. Rhinelander's attorneys, were granted $1,500 by Supreme Court Justice Morchauser, Thursday. They sought $5,000.

The allowance was vigorously opposed by Isaac N. Mills, counsel for Rhinelander. Mr. Mills declared that the $18,500 they had received was sufficient. Mills said that this amount represented one-tenth of Rhinelander's personal fortune. This was successfully denied by Mrs. Rhinelander's attorneys.
